a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Ricardo Wurmus <rekado@elephly.net>2024-01-22 12:44:46 +0100
committerRicardo Wurmus <rekado@elephly.net>2024-01-22 13:54:44 +0100
commit389c6082a440238accdd4e2df864135004dbb806 (patch)
treef8f8627b72a17cb4136b31ecc1b1c553663e6b64
parent29353820f2df8e4434bbdae2d36b36d0151cc027 (diff)
downloadguix-389c6082a440238accdd4e2df864135004dbb806.tar.gz
guix-389c6082a440238accdd4e2df864135004dbb806.zip
import/cran: Set HOME when ExperimentHub is among the inputs.
* guix/import/cran.scm (phases-for-inputs): Add 'set-HOME phase when ExperimentHub is among inputs. Change-Id: Ie3a2443934704eed8694a76a651b806209722421
-rw-r--r--guix/import/cran.scm4
1 files changed, 3 insertions, 1 deletions
diff --git a/guix/import/cran.scm b/guix/import/cran.scm
index d49bd96c9a..db9250faec 100644
--- a/guix/import/cran.scm
+++ b/guix/import/cran.scm
@@ -677,7 +677,9 @@ of META, a package in REPOSITORY."
of package names for all input packages."
(let ((rules
(list (lambda ()
- (and (member "styler" input-names)
+ (and (any (lambda (name)
+ (member name '("styler" "ExperimentHub")))
+ input-names)
'(add-after 'unpack 'set-HOME
(lambda _ (setenv "HOME" "/tmp")))))
(lambda ()